MetroPoll Research Company's December 2024 Pulse of Turkey survey has been conducted.

According to the survey results, the AKP was measured as the leading party with 21.3 percent of the vote before the distribution of undecided voters. The CHP took second place with 19.1 percent.

When undecided voters were distributed, the AKP's vote share rose to 32.8 percent, while the CHP received 29.4 percent.

With these results, the AKP moved 3.5 points ahead of the CHP. The DEM Party ranked third with 10.7 percent, and the MHP ranked fourth with 7.6 percent. The IYI Party received 5.7 percent of the vote.

AKP INCREASED ITS VOTES

In the poll conducted the previous month, the CHP was 0.2 points ahead of the AKP. However, in the latest poll, while the CHP lost 1 point, the AKP rose back to the first place with a 3-point increase.

MANSUR YAVAŞ AT THE TOP

In the survey, the politician with the highest approval rating was Ankara Metropolitan Municipality Mayor Mansur Yavaş with 58.5 percent.

He was followed by Istanbul Metropolitan Municipality Mayor Ekrem İmamoğlu with 47.2 percent.

President Recep Tayyip Erdoğan ranked third with an approval rating of 46.3 percent.

MHP leader Devlet Bahçeli found himself in fourth place, and CHP Chairman Özgür Özel in fifth place.
